ingredients
- 1 cup spelt berries (also called "whole grain spelt" or "farro" boiled according to package instructions)
- 1 lemon (organic, small to medium in size, grated zest and juice of)
- 2 tablespoons liquid honey
- 3 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il (I use canola oil)
- 100 g dried cranberries (the sweetened kind, roughly chopped)
- 100 g hazelnuts (dry roasted on a hot frying pan. Remove as much as possible of the brown "shell lining" after roasti)
- 3 -5 stalks spring onions (thinly sliced, you can also substitute the spring onions with 2 finely sliced stalks of celery)
- 1 -2 teaspoon dried mint (or to taste)
- 1⁄4 teaspoon salt (to taste)
- 1⁄4 teaspoon pepper (to taste)
directions
- Mix everything together - no particular order nescessary.
